    Chicago Fire VS Vancouver Whitecaps

    USA Major League Soccer

    The Chicago Fire's recent three - game winning streak has significantly lifted their morale. However, the previous losing streaks have shown their lack of consistency. On the other hand, the Vancouver Whitecaps have a steady overall form, with only one loss in the last ten games. Nevertheless, their away - game results have been a bit inconsistent. In terms of tactics, both teams are good at counter - attacking and controlling the game in their own half. The Chicago Fire stands out with their excellent ball - stealing ability. Meanwhile, the Vancouver Whitecaps have an edge in creating goal - scoring opportunities and maintaining the lead. But the weakness in their wing defense and individual skills could be exploited by the home team. Regarding the standings, the Chicago Fire, ranked third in the Eastern Conference, face intense competition. The Vancouver Whitecaps are at the top of the Western Conference, but they have to deal with injury problems on the road. Four players, including attacking midfielder Gold and center - back Halbany, are absent, which affects the team's depth. The home team also has three injured players, but their recent winning streak gives them a psychological advantage. Looking at the historical head - to - head records, the Chicago Fire has a slight upper hand, and this psychological factor might play a role in the upcoming match.
